Gaines, Hornets sweep titles at Bowling Green Invite

BOWLING GREEN, Mo. - Fulton junior Mason Gaines locked up the individual title with a time of 16 minutes, 16.63 seconds in guiding the Hornets to the team championship at the Bowling Green Invitational on Friday.

In the varsity girls' division, North Callaway junior Reyna Schmauch secured individual honors in 20:04.07 as the Ladybirds came in second.

The New Bloomfield Wildcats finished fourth on the boys' side as sophomore Robert Morningstar medalled by taking 12th in 17:45.88.

Gaines was one of five medalists in the top 10 for Fulton, which compiled 23 points. Junior Nathan Quick placed fourth in 16:58.01, sophomore Brock Fisher was fifth in 17:00.03 , junior Gabe Luebbert came in sixth in 17:07.38 and senior Tanner Steffen finished seventh in 17:08.78.

Schmauch was one of three medalists for North Callaway, which totalled 42 points. Freshman Daelyn Schmauch earned fourth place in 20:45.65 and junior Kyla Bertschinger was ninth in 21:15.53.

All three schools now turn their attention toward district competition next Saturday. Fulton competes in the Class 3, District 5 championships at Helias in Jefferson City, North Callaway runs in the Class 2, District 3 championships at New Haven, and New Bloomfield competes in the Class 2, District 4 championships at Father Tolton in Columbia.
